    Modern Warfare 3 topped the UK video game sales chart in its first week, becoming the biggest video game launch in history by revenue. [88] By November 21, 2011, the game remained the bestselling title in the United Kingdom, despite sales dropping by 87%. [89] Modern Warfare 3 held the top spot on the UK charts for four weeks running.

    Television in Canada officially began with the sign-on of the nation's first television stations in Montreal and Toronto in 1952. As with most media in Canada, the television industry, and the television programming available in that country, are strongly influenced by media in the United States, perhaps to an extent not seen in any other major industrialized nation.
